Alas More of the Same., January 7, 2005
This review is from: Scripts and Strategies in Hypnotherapy, Volume 2 (Hardcover)
Relating to Vol I of Mr. Allen's book, I stated:
"Scripts and Strategies in Hypnotherapy, Volume 1" by Roger P. Allen is a small work that provides a series of rather uninformative hypnosis scripts. This work seems to be more of the same.
Of all the techniques I have used and read over the past 20 years, I have never seen such long and at times boring narratives. I was not impressed with the pointless metaphors which I believe a previous reviewer mentioned. Simplicity is at times much better in hypnosis than a complex and at times long and pointless story. Although the concept of misdirection may be used, the script should never be BORING.
I was very dismayed to learn that I have paid so much for such a useless piece of tripe. Yes the best word to describe the book is terrible.
Volume II is no better than Vol. I. It is just more of the same.
